“Lytton, British Columbia, hit 121 degrees on Tuesday -- the highest temperature ever recorded in Canada. The record was broken on Sunday and then again on Monday.
The coroner's service normally receives about 130 death reports over a four-day period. From Friday through Monday, at least 233 deaths were reported, the chief coroner said, adding "this number will increase as data continues to be updated."”
“At least 76 people died in Oregon and Washington from excessive heat during a stifling heat wave that hit the Pacific Northwest in the past several days, according to local authorities.”
